Section 400.9-506 Effect of errors or omissions.

Effective - 01 Jul 2001

400.9-506. Effect of errors or omissions. — (a) A financing statement substantially satisfying the requirements of this part is effective, even if it has minor errors or omissions, unless the errors or omissions make the financing statement seriously misleading.

(b) Except as otherwise provided in subsection (c), a financing statement that fails sufficiently to provide the name of the debtor in accordance with section 400.9-503(a) is seriously misleading.

(c) If a search of the records of the filing office under the debtor's correct name, using the filing office's standard search logic, if any, would disclose a financing statement that fails sufficiently to provide the name of the debtor in accordance with section 400.9-503(a), the name provided does not make the financing statement seriously misleading.

(d) For purposes of section 400.9-508(b), the "debtor's correct name" in subsection (c) means the correct name of the new debtor.
